New Visa ballot process for Australian Work and Holiday program
 

In a recent announcement, the Australian government reported the launch of a new pre-application system for the Subclass 462(Work and Holiday) visa program. The country is planning to implement a new ballot system for Work and Holiday visa applicants from India, Vietnam, and China.

The ballot system will be selecting applicants randomly from partner countries where the number of applicants exceed the number of spots available. The new visa ballot system aims to facilitate the fair, simple, and transparent method of selection of candidates.

Applicants from India, Vietnam, and China can apply for a first, second, and third Work and Holiday visa. Indian applicants can register for the program in the latter half of 2024. Arrangements are being made for applicants from other participating countries.

Australian Work and Holiday program
 

The First Work and Holiday (Subclass 462) visa allows candidates aged between 18-30 years to have an extended vacation in Australia while working in the country to sponsor their trip. Applicants can take up short-term work in the country to fund their Holiday. They can also travel to and from the country or study up to 4 months in Australia.

Send Work and Holiday Visa holders aged between 18-30 years are allowed to have a second working in Australia. Applicants from India, Vietnam and China who already have a first work and holiday visa can apply for the second and third Work and Holiday Visa.
 

Australia-India Economic Cooperation and Trade Agreement (ECTA)
 

The government of Australia has decided to extend applications for work and Holidays to 1000 Indian citizens each year as per the Australia-India Economic Cooperation and Trade Agreement (ECTA).

Eligible Indians aged between 18 and 30 years can apply for Work and Holiday Visa for one year and take up short-term employment or study programs while enjoying their vacation in Australia. Applicants must pay AUD 25 to register for the new visa ballot process.
